Prescribing Hope: Trapped on the Streets
Free on SceneLog — log in or create an account to track it.
Overview
For homeless people incapacitated by mental illness in Hawaii, years go by and nothing changes. They’re trapped. And their families struggle to get them help, despite a law passed five years ago that was supposed to offer a way out. Allyson Blair goes inside the effort to get these people treated, and shows what happens when they finally receive help.
